February 12, 2019Two employers sent to jail for breach of OHS lawsUntil now, no one in Australia has gone to jail for breaching Australia's Occupational Health and Safety laws. But over the last few weeks, two employers, one in Victoria and another in Queensland have been put behind bars for recklessly causing death....more18minPlay

January 22, 2019Beaming prisoners into courtrooms; the pros and cons of Audio Visual LinksIn recent years there has been an explosion in the use of Audio Visual Links (AVLs) between prisons and courtrooms. This development has been welcomed by many prisoners, but some don't like being 'reduced to a bunch of pixels'....more29minPlay
